Our chaga is never farmed. It is carefully sought throughout Canada's boreal forest, where it forms slowly on living birch trees over decades of northern weather. Each harvest reflects patience, restraint, and respect for the forest ecosystem.
Wild boreal chaga is a rare forest-grown material, shaped entirely by living birch trees, the northern climate, and the landscapes of Canada.

While King Chaga watches over the wild forests, the rest of the Mushroom Council comes from carefully cultivated organic mushroom gardens.
Lion's Mane, Reishi, Turkey Tail, Cordyceps, Maitake, and Shiitake are intentionally cultivated using certified organic growing practices that support purity, consistency, and sustainable production.
By cultivating these species responsibly, we help protect wild mushroom populations while making traditional mushroom products more widely accessible.
